Chelsea Reportedly Leading the Race to Sign Liam Delap for £40 Million This Summer, Ahead of Manchester United

Ipswich Town striker Liam Delap has been widely praised for his performances this season, scoring 10 goals and providing two assists since joining the club last summer.

Despite his impressive individual displays, the 22-year-old’s efforts may not be enough to prevent Kieran McKenna’s side from being relegated. Nevertheless, his form has caught the attention of several Premier League clubs.

Arsenal, Chelsea, Liverpool, and Manchester United are all reportedly monitoring Delap with a view to a move at the end of the season. If Ipswich faces relegation, they could be forced to sell him for a reported £40 million fee. According to Caught Offside, Chelsea are currently in the lead for his signature.

With Nicolas Jackson struggling for form and Christopher Nkunku not seen as a natural striker by Enzo Maresca, Chelsea are expected to focus on signing a forward in the upcoming summer transfer window. While the club has been linked to several high-profile strikers, Delap might be a more affordable option as they look to strengthen their defense and midfield.

Delap’s performances suggest he’s ready for a move to a bigger club like Chelsea. Despite playing for a relegation-threatened team, he has shown he can handle pressure. Surrounded by better-quality teammates at Stamford Bridge, the young Englishman could unlock even more of his potential.

Although Manchester City included a buyback clause in their deal with Ipswich last summer, they are unlikely to activate it following their recent signing of Omar Marmoush. With Chelsea reportedly in pole position, it could soon be a matter of time before Delap moves to West London.
